タグ

関連タグで絞り込む (196)

タグの絞り込みを解除

flashに関するlizyのブックマーク (330)

  • Comet/Ajaxの上を行く技術 - Blog by Sadayuki Furuhashi

    上を行くかどうかは知りませんが :-p Ajaxはクライアントの都合でサーバーに通信を仕掛けるpull型の通信ができ、Cometはサーバーが好きなタイミングでクライアントへデータを送りつけるpush型の通信ができるわけですが、新たに双方向の通信ができる技術を開発しました。 具体的には、JavaScriptとサーバーの間で双方向のRPCができます。すなわち、サーバーからクライアント側のJavaScriptのメソッドが呼べるし、逆にクライアント側からサーバー側のメソッドを呼ぶこともできます。 サーバー側で call("addMessage", "Hello!") とやると、JavaScript側の function addMessage(msg) { ... } という関数が呼ばれたりします。 この技術を使って、試しにチャットシステムを作ってみました > デモ (ソースコード)*1 リアルタイ

    Comet/Ajaxの上を行く技術 - Blog by Sadayuki Furuhashi
    lizy
    lizy 2008/05/05
    ポート80以外を使う時点で普及しづらい気がする
  • 第8回 Flexで本格Webアプリケーションを作ってみよう | gihyo.jp

    前回まではActionScript 3.0を利用したプログラミングを解説してきました。ActionScript 3.0はグラフィカルな表示には強いのですが、機能的なWebアプリケーションを作るのにはあまり向いていません。 Flashでアプリケーションを作る場合は、Flexというフレームワークが便利です。Flexと聞くとお金が必要なイメージがあるかもしれませんが、FlexはFlex 3 SDKに付属する無料のフレームワークです。 Flexフレームワークには便利なコンポーネントが用意されています。また、MXMLと呼ばれるXMLにもとづいたフォーマットでアプリケーションの見た目を記述することができます。今回は、Flexフレームワークの使い方を簡単にご紹介していきます。 MXMLでコンポーネントを配置 早速サンプルを見てみましょう。MXMLでアプリケーションの見た目を記述してみます。 <?xml

    第8回 Flexで本格Webアプリケーションを作ってみよう | gihyo.jp
  • Flexアプリケーション作成でよくある10の間違い

    この記事ではAdobeのJames Ward氏(source)がこの記事(参考記事)とは別のFlexに関するトップ10を教えてくれる。Flexはオープンソースのアプリケーション開発環境で、Flash Playerを使ったウェブのリッチインターネットアプリケーション(RIA)を作ることができ、またAdobe AIRを使えばデスクトップで動くアプリケーションも作れる。総合的に見てFlexは使いやすくパワフルなフレームワークだが、今回はFlexアプリケーションを作る時によくある間違いに注目してみよう。 Flexを初めて知る人はInfoQの最近の記事Adobe Flex Basics(参考記事)を読んでもらえばこのフレームワークについての簡潔な概要を知ることができる。さて、10の間違いを挙げよう。 RIAフレームワークをWeb 1.0アプリケーションを作るのに使ってしまう(新しいテクノロジなのに以

    Flexアプリケーション作成でよくある10の間違い
  • Flexとオープンウェブ

    Spring BootによるAPIバックエンド構築実践ガイド 第2版 何千人もの開発者が、InfoQのミニブック「Practical Guide to Building an API Back End with Spring Boot」から、Spring Bootを使ったREST API構築の基礎を学んだ。このでは、出版時に新しくリリースされたバージョンである Spring Boot 2 を使用している。しかし、Spring Boot3が最近リリースされ、重要な変...

    Flexとオープンウェブ
  • ActionScriptによるWebの3Dグラフィックス再入門 (2) - シェーディングでもっと3Dらしく:CodeZine

    前回はワイヤーフレームの三角形をくるくる回すところまで紹介しました。その先の課題としていろいろなものがあると書いて終わりとなりましたが、今回はその中からシェーディングを取り上げて説明します。また、ActionScript 3のpackageの概念などについても必要に応じて説明します。 Flex 3 SDKのリリースとFlashDevelopのバージョンアップ 早速今回の内容に移りたいのですが、前回の記事掲載からの間に開発に大きく影響する変化があったので、そこをまず説明します。最も大きいのはFlex 3 SDKがベータ版ではなくなり、Adobe Open Sourceで公開されたことです。これにより従来のFlex 3 SDKは3月15日付で使えなくなりました。コンパイルしてみると、期限切れを表すエラーが出るはずです。 正式バージョンのFlex 3 SDKはFlex 3 SDK Downloa

  • 第4回 Flashのイベント処理を理解する | gihyo.jp

    前回までは画面に描画する方法をご紹介しました。単に表示するだけではつまらないので、今回はマウスに反応するFlashを作りながら、Flashのイベント処理を理解していきましょう。 Flashでイベントを扱う方法は、HTMLのDOMイベントとほとんど同じです。DOMイベントをご存知の方にとっては理解しやすい内容かもしれません。 クリックイベントを拾う さっそくシンプルな例から進めていきましょう。クリックした場所にランダムな色で円を表示するFlashです。 package { import flash.display.Sprite; import flash.events.MouseEvent; public class ClickTest extends Sprite { public function ClickTest():void { // クリックイベントを監視する stage.add

    第4回 Flashのイベント処理を理解する | gihyo.jp
  • いまさら聞けないFlex、そして、いまこそ入門のとき!?(1/2) ─ @IT

    いまさら聞けないFlex、 そして、いまこそ入門のとき!? Flex 3正式版リリース! Flexの過去・現在・未来 クラスメソッド株式会社 篠崎 大地 2008/3/31 Flex 3正式版リリース! いまさら聞けない「Flex」とは? 2008年2月22日に、米Adobe Systems社(以下、Adobe)はFlex 3およびAdobe AIR(以下、AIR) 1.0の正式版をリリースしました(参考「Adobe AIR 1.0がついに公開~Web技術デスクトップアプリを開発~」)。AIRは、1年ほどのβ期間を経てのリリース、Flex 3は、1年半振りのメジャーバージョンアップとなります。 「Flex」とは、Flash Playerで動作するFlash/ActionScriptベースのRIA/リッチクライアント・システムを簡単に開発するためのフレームワークです。RIA開発の選択肢とし

  • 窓の杜 - 【NEWS】各種文書をFlashドキュメントへ変換できる「Print2Flash Free Edition」

    各種文書ファイルをWeb上で公開・共有したいときに便利な仮想プリンター「Print2Flash Free Edition」v2.7.1が、2月13日に公開された。Windows 2000/XP/Srever 2003/Vistaに対応するフリーソフトで、利用は個人かつ非商用目的に限られる。現在、作者のホームページからダウンロードできる。 近年、Web上で文書を公開するときにはPDFファイルが利用されることが多く、「Adobe Reader」をパソコンにインストールしていれば、Web上のPDFファイルをWebブラウザー内に表示できる。しかし厳密に言うと、PDFファイルはWebコンテンツ用の規格ではないため、「Adobe Reader」がWebブラウザーに代わってPDFファイルを表示しているにすぎない。 一方、Web上で公開されている動画の世界に目を向けてみると、“YouTube”などではFl

  • 【コラム】OS X ハッキング! (269) Photoshop Expressに未来のアプリ像を見た! | パソコン | マイコミジャーナル

    Webアプリ化したフォトショップ「Photoshop Express」のβ版が公開 人間ドックの結果が芳しくなかったこの私、カリウム豊富な材の摂取に努めるなど、にわかに対策へと乗り出しました。「Nike + iPod」も試そうかしら。そこのあなたも、健康にはご注意を。 さて、今回は「Adobe Photoshop Express(β版)」について。OS Xのテクノロジーとは直接関係ないが、OS Xユーザのうちかなりの人数がPhotoshopユーザでもあるはず。筆者も、その"キラーアプリ"がWebアプリ化するという話を耳にして以来、実物の登場を心待ちにしていたクチだ。それでは早速、Photoshop Expressの使用感などを紹介してみよう。 Photoshop Express、ココが見どころ これまでアプリケーションといえば、ローカルに(ダウンロードして)置いた状態で使用することが当た

  • MOONGIFT: » Flashによるイメージギャラリー「Art Flash Gallery」:オープンソースを毎日紹介

    写真をただ並べてみせるだけでは面白くない。その見せ方、イフェクト一つで印象が全く変わってくる。同じ楽しむならいかに格好よく、気持ちよく見せられるかが大事になる。 JavaScriptを使ったイメージギャラリーもあるが、こちらはFlashを使ったソフトウェアだ。 今回紹介するフリーウェアはArt Flash Gallery、様々なイフェクトが特徴のイメージギャラリーソフトウェアだ。 Art Flash Galleryは上に拡大写真、下に写真のサムネイルが表示される。下の写真は反射を使っていて、格好よく表示される。また、マウスを当てていると拡大表示する機能もある。 各写真を切り替えたり、クリックしたときには音が鳴る仕組みもある。また、写真の数が多い場合は、スライドして写真が切り替わる機能もある。拡大写真は左上から斜めに表示されていくのも良い。 写真のリストをXMLで定義しておくのが若干面倒なこ

    MOONGIFT: » Flashによるイメージギャラリー「Art Flash Gallery」:オープンソースを毎日紹介
    lizy
    lizy 2008/03/25
  • MOONGIFT: » オープンソースのFLVプレーヤ「NonverBlaster」:オープンソースを毎日紹介

    Webブラウザ上で何でも行うようになっている。ビューワーについてはFlashが秀逸で、音楽を聴いたり、動画を見たり、ドキュメントを閲覧するようなことがブラウザ上だけで完結するようになっている。 動画はどのサービスでも有効に使われているが、自サイト内でプレーヤを提供したければこちらをどうぞ。 今回紹介するオープンソース・ソフトウェアはNonverBlaster、オープンソースのFLVプレーヤだ。 NonverBlasterはシンプルなインタフェースのFLVプレーヤで、再生と音量調整、そしてフルスクリーンモードがサポートされている。URLでFLVファイルを指定するだけで使える手軽さが良い。 自動再生、フルスクリーンモードの許可、各種色の設定などをJavaScriptから行えるのも特徴だ。再生するだけであれば、プレーヤは殆ど変更する必要はなく、HTML側だけで終われるのが嬉しい点だ。 自分の撮っ

    MOONGIFT: » オープンソースのFLVプレーヤ「NonverBlaster」:オープンソースを毎日紹介
  • TechCrunch Japanese アーカイブ » Adobe、ジョブズの否定にもかかわらずiPhone向けFlashを勝手に準備中

    TechCrunch Daily News Every weekday and Sunday, you can get the best of TechCrunch’s coverage. Startups Weekly Startups are the core of TechCrunch, so get our best coverage delivered weekly.

    TechCrunch Japanese アーカイブ » Adobe、ジョブズの否定にもかかわらずiPhone向けFlashを勝手に準備中
  • TechCrunch | Startup and Technology News

    The French Secretary of State for the Digital Economy as of this year, Marina Ferrari, revealed this year’s laureates during VivaTech week in Paris. According to its promoters, this fifth…

    TechCrunch | Startup and Technology News
  • 第1回 無料でFlash作りに挑戦!Flex 3 SDKを導入してみよう | gihyo.jp

    Flashを作るには何万円もする専用ソフトが必要…、デザイナーが使うものだから敷居が高い…。そう考えてる方も多いのではないでしょうか。実はそんなことはありません。 Adobe社が無料で提供している開発環境「Flex 3 SDK」を利用すれば、ActionScript 3.0というプログラミング言語でFlashを作成できます。ActionScript 3.0はECMAScriptに準拠しているため、プログラマの方にとってもなじみやすい言語といえます。 この連載ではプログラマの方に向けて、サンプルを交えながら、ActionScriptでFlashを作る手法を解説していきます。 ActionScript 3.0でHello World! いきなりですが、ActionScript 3.0のサンプルコードを見てみましょう。定番のHello World!です。 package{ import flas

    第1回 無料でFlash作りに挑戦!Flex 3 SDKを導入してみよう | gihyo.jp
  • 各種ドキュメントをFlash化·Print2Flash Free Edition MOONGIFT

    ちょっと前までは文書をPDF化するのが便利だった。プリンタドライバとして動作するPDF作成ツールも数多く登場している。PDFを作成するのは決して難しいものではなくなっている。 次の段階はドキュメントのFlash化だ。この利点は何だろう、閲覧は当然としてブラウザ内で見られるのが便利な点だ。 今回紹介するフリーウェアはPrint2Flash Free Edition、プリンタドライバとして動作するFlash生成ソフトウェアだ。 実はPrint2Flash自体はフリー版ではないものを持っている。Memotuneの中で一時的に利用していた。FlashPaper同様にFlashであればOSの垣根を越えて、さらにブラウザ内でインライン表示できるのが便利だ。 Print2Flash Free Editionはそのフリー版であり、個人の非商用に限って無料で利用できる。利用方法は簡単で、プリンタのように印刷

    各種ドキュメントをFlash化·Print2Flash Free Edition MOONGIFT
  • TechCrunch Japanese アーカイブ » AdobeのFlashでは、Steve Jobsには不足

    The French Secretary of State for the Digital Economy as of this year, Marina Ferrari, revealed this year’s laureates during VivaTech week in Paris. According to its promoters, this fifth…

    TechCrunch Japanese アーカイブ » AdobeのFlashでは、Steve Jobsには不足
  • FLVからMP3を簡単に抽出できるフリーソフト「FLV Extract v1.3.0」リリース:CodeZine

    Flashビデオ(FLV)から動画や音声を抽出できるフリーソフト「FLV Extract v1.3.0」が公開された。作者のWebサイトよりダウンロードできる。実行するためには.NET Framework 2.0がインストールされている必要がある。 FLV Extract起動後に表示される小さなウィンドウに対してFLVファイルをドラッグ&ドロップするだけで、動画・音声ファイルを抽出する。ビデオはAVI(H.263/FLV1、VP6/VP6F)で、音声はMP3で保存される。 【関連リンク】 ・Moitah.net

    lizy
    lizy 2008/02/29
  • Ring

    Ringとは、リクルートグループ会社従業員を対象にした新規事業提案制度です。 『ゼクシィ』『R25』『スタディサプリ』など数多くの事業を生み出してきた新規事業制度は、 1982年に「RING」としてスタートし、1990年「New RING」と改定、そして2018年「Ring」にリニューアルしました。 リクルートグループの従業員は誰でも自由に参加することができ、 テーマはリクルートの既存領域に限らず、ありとあらゆる領域が対象です。 リクルートにとって、Ringとは「新しい価値の創造」というグループ経営理念を体現する場であり、 従業員が自分の意思で新規事業を提案・実現できる機会です。 Ringフロー その後の事業開発手法 Ringを通過した案件は、事業化を検討する権利を得て、事業開発を行います。 さまざまな事業開発の手法がありますが、例えば既存領域での事業開発の場合は、 担当事業会社内で予算や

    lizy
    lizy 2008/02/27
  • Tanablog: サーバを経由せずに Flash の内容を画像に変換する

    Flash で描画したベクター画像を img タグで表示させるデモを作った。肝はサーバプログラムを経由しないところ。 IE 以外のモダンブラウザなら、下の灰色の領域に線を描くと、その下に PNG 画像が現れるはず。 ペイントツール部分は、func09 さんのソースをお借りした。 仕組み PNGEncoder で PNG の ByteArray を作る その ByteArray を Base64 エンコードする その文字列を ExternalInterface でブラウザに送る data スキーマで画像を表示させる var bmp:BitmapData = new BitmapData(300, 300); bmp.draw(canvas); var base64Text:String = Base64.encodeByteArray(PNGEncoder.encode(bmp)); Ext

  • Flex・Flash開発用のサードパーティ製ツール

    Spring BootによるAPIバックエンド構築実践ガイド 第2版 何千人もの開発者が、InfoQのミニブック「Practical Guide to Building an API Back End with Spring Boot」から、Spring Bootを使ったREST API構築の基礎を学んだ。このでは、出版時に新しくリリースされたバージョンである Spring Boot 2 を使用している。しかし、Spring Boot3が最近リリースされ、重要な変...

    Flex・Flash開発用のサードパーティ製ツール